2. Simple habits
- Cap minutes per sitting and set a “hard stop” alarm.
- Keep one tab or window so the experience does not run silently in the background for hours.
- Skip late-night sessions if they disturb sleep: screens already compete with rest.
3. If play stops feeling fun
Patterns like chasing “just one more spin,” hiding screen time, or using games to avoid stress may signal that an outside conversation could help, even in a no-money product.
